Gruv-X Mundo Percussion Wood Block, Natural Satin (GRVMN-NS)
Combining the tone of a wood shell and the side of a metal timbale, the GRVMN-NS Mundo from Gruv-X is a unique percussive instrument that will add sweet sonic coloring to any setup. The Mundo can be used to tap Afro-Cuban music's most iconic rhythm: "palito." This rhythm is typically played on the side of a timbale or, when one is not available, drummers will often play the rhythm on the side of a floor tom, which can cause damage. The Mundo is made from a combination of American rock maple and copper, capturing the unique tone of a timbale with a mix of metal and wood sound. This percussion piece mounts easily onto just about any size drum and features a tone hole in the upper half of the body that projects its sound nicely.
